The Timetraveller's Guide to Medieval London

Rate this book
It’s all here:

• The stinking streets and hovel houses • Choice medieval diseases—plague, smallpox, leprosy—and how to get them • Rotten rulers and gruesome tortures • A day in the life of a London serf • The real Dick Whittington • Richard III and the princes in the Tower • The creepy clergy and naughty nuns • Hotel rates at the Bloody Tower • Streamline lavatories and the new hygienic sewerage systems (only kidding!) • Petty crimes and savage punishments

Famine, the Black Death, impossible taxes, open sewers in the middle of the streets, livestock in your living room and criminal kings are just some of the pleasures of the city at its smelliest and vilest moment.

96 pages, Paperback

First published September 1, 2004
